Kerala Vidyajyothi Scheme 2021
So the scheme is launched by Social Justice Department. In this plan, the Kerala government will give financial help to the differently-abled people who are willing to continue their studies further. There was a survey conducted in the state according to which, there are 7,79,793 different types of disabled persons in the state, out of which 1,30,799 are under 18 years of age.
So the government will help such people financially so that they can continue their studies, purchase uniforms, and fulfill their dreams.

Assistance Amount
The following amount will be given to the beneficiaries under the scheme:-
Course / Class | Assistance for Study materials | Assistance for Uniform |
9th to 10th Standard | Rs. 1000 each (50 children from each district) | Rs. 1500 (30 children from each district) |
+1, +2, ITI, Polytechnic, VHSC | Rs. 2000 each (50 children from each district) | Rs. 1500/- each (30 children from each district) |
Degree, Diploma, Professional Courses | Rs. 3000 each (25 children from each district) | Nil |
Post Graduation | Rs. 3000 each (20 children from each district) | Nil |
Eligibility Criteria
The applicant needs to pass the following criteria to enroll themselves:-
- The applicant must be a resident of Kerala state.
- An applicant must be studying in a government school.
- The applicant must be 40% or more disabled
- The applicant must belong to the BPL (Below Poverty Line) family.
Required Documents
The applicant needs to have the following documents for enrollment:-
- Disability certificate
- BPL certificate
- Bank passbook
- Duly filled application form check by the head of the institution
- Recent passport size photograph
- Government school certificate
Disabilities included under Kerala Vidyajyothi scheme
Disabilities included under Kerala Vidyajyothi Scheme are as follows:-
- Low vision
- Autism spectrum disorder
- Blindness
- Acid attack victim
- Locomotor disability
- Leprosy cured person
- Intellectual disability
- Hearing impairment
- Dwarfism
- Chronic neurological conditions
- Cerebral Palsy
- Thalassemia
- Speech and language disability
- Specific learning disability
- Sickle cell anemia
- Parkinson’s disease
- Muscular dystrophy
- Multiple sclerosis
- Multiple disabilities including deafblindness
- Mental illness

Application Process
Follow the following steps to enroll yourself:-
- Download the application form i.e provided to you and take the printout of it.
- After this fill in all the required details and do attach the required documents.
- Then submit the application form to the concerned department.
- After all the verification assistance will be transferred to all the beneficiaries through direct benefit transfer (DBT) directly to the bank account.
